On April 4th, 2025, the Khayrallah Center will collaborate with the Triangle Lebanese American Center to host a screening of WE NEVER LEFT.

- Logline: Set during the Lebanese revolution, WE NEVER LEFT portrays a heart-wrenching duality between Beirut and New York, an impassioned testament to the Lebanese diaspora’s unrequited but irrepressible love for their homeland.

- Synopsis: Saying goodbye to loved ones at the Beirut airport has become an unfortunate tradition in Lebanon, even a curse. Lebanese emigrants, driven abroad by decades of turmoil, are more than double those still left in their homeland. After civil protests erupt in Lebanon on October 17th 2019, WE NEVER LEFT follows three young Lebanese expats as they wage the Lebanese revolution from New York and fight for a better country. As they go through their collective journey, they each individually confront their relationship with their homeland and their own complicated identities. This is the story of political and personal revolutions a world away from home.

- Director's biography: Loulwa Khoury is a New York based filmmaker, film editor born and raised in Beirut. She edited Paradise Without People (2019), Dusty and Stones (2022), Joy Dancer (2024) and Traces of Home. She also directed her first feature documentary, We Never Left. Her other work includes award-winning documentaries City of Ghosts (2017), Some Kind of Heaven (2020) and It Will Be Chaos (2018). She was also one of the mentees of the Karen Schmeer Editing Fellowship Diversity Program of the year 2019-2020 and a fellow in the Sundance Co//ab Art of Editing Fellowship 2020, and is currently in the DOC NYC x VC Storytelling Incubator cohort as well as a winner of the Creative Power Award.
